Essential cleaning supplies needed

Essential cleaning supplies needed

When it comes to cleaning restrooms quickly, having the right supplies on hand makes all the difference. I’ve learned that stocking up on essential cleaning tools not only saves time but also ensures a thorough job. Each time I set out to clean, I make it a point to gather my supplies beforehand to streamline the process. Trust me, this small step is invaluable.

Here’s a list of the cleaning supplies I always keep ready:
– Multi-surface cleaner
– Disinfectant wipes
– Toilet bowl cleaner
– Scrub brushes (preferably with long handles)
– Microfiber cloths
– Rubber gloves
– A mop and bucket
– Air freshener

In my experience, having these items within reach means I can tackle any restroom mess swiftly. Step-by-step cleaning process

When I approach restroom cleaning, I follow a structured, step-by-step process that maximizes efficiency. First, I always start by decluttering surfaces. It might seem small, but clearing away items like personal toiletries or towels sets a clean stage for the actual scrubbing. I once spent a few extra minutes on this step and noticed a dramatic difference in how the final clean looked.

Next, I tackle the toilet itself. I apply toilet bowl cleaner and let it sit while I clean the surrounding areas. I find this waiting time to be perfect for wiping down sinks and counters with a disinfectant, which leaves everything sparkling. Interestingly, when I first combined these tasks, I was amazed at how much time it saved me. I’ve become more efficient, and now, my approach feels almost like a dance—each step flows into the next.

Finally, I finish up by mopping the floor and giving everything a final inspection. Step Description
Clear Surfaces Remove all items from countertops and sinks to prepare for thorough cleaning.
Apply Cleaners Use toilet bowl cleaner and disinfectant on surfaces, allowing time for it to work.
Wipe Down Areas Clean sinks, counters, and mirrors, ensuring everything is spotless.
Mop Floor Finish by mopping the floor and doing a final check for any missed spots.

Using the right technique can also make a world of difference. For example, I’ve learned to use a top-to-bottom approach—cleaning surfaces that are higher up first, like mirrors and light fixtures, and moving downward. This technique prevents dirt and debris from falling onto already cleaned areas, saving me the disappointment of having to backtrack.
